The Role of B Vitamins
B vitamins are a group of essential nutrients that play a significant role in energy production and metabolism. They include B1 (thiamine), B2 (riboflavin), B3 (niacin), B5 (pantothenic acid), B6 (pyridoxine), B7 (biotin), B9 (folate), and B12 (cobalamin). Here’s how they contribute to fat burning:

Energy Conversion: B vitamins help convert food into energy, preventing the storage of excess calories as fat.
Boosting Metabolism: These vitamins enhance metabolic processes, allowing your body to burn more calories.
Stress Reduction: B vitamins can alleviate stress, reducing emotional eating tendencies.

FAQs
Q: Can I get enough vitamin D from sunlight alone?

A: While sunlight is an excellent source of vitamin D, many factors, such as location and skin type, can affect your body’s ability to produce it. Dietary sources and supplements are often necessary.

Q: Are there specific foods rich in B vitamins?

A: Yes, B vitamins can be found in various foods, including leafy greens, whole grains, eggs, and lean meats.

Q: Is it possible to consume too much magnesium through supplements?

A: Excessive magnesium intake from supplements can lead to diarrhea and gastrointestinal issues. It’s best to consult with a healthcare professional for guidance.

Q: Can zinc supplements help with weight loss?

A: While zinc is essential for overall health, it’s not a magic solution for weight loss. It should be part of a balanced diet and healthy lifestyle.

Q: Is iron supplementation necessary for everyone?

A: Iron supplementation should only be pursued under the guidance of a healthcare professional after assessing your iron levels. Excessive iron intake can be harmful.
